Use the equation below to find y, if m=6, x=3, and b = 10.
y=mx+b

Respuesta :

hbj
hbj hbj
  • 04-09-2020

Answer:

y = 28

Step-by-step explanation:

y = mx + b

plug in values

y = (6)(3) + (10)

multiply

y = 18 + (10)

add

y = 28
